Get startedBicester House is a two-bedroom semi-detached house in Whitchurch (RG28 7HE). It has a recorded floor area of 73 m² (around 786 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band B. At 73 m² this is the 3rd smallest of 4 units on EPC record in Bicester House, where floor areas span 65–75 m². The building's EPC ratings span D to C, with this unit at the top. The latest certificate (November 2020) shows a C (score 70). When first surveyed in September 2010 the rating was E,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Very Poor to Average and lighting went from Poor to Good.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 3.4% per year against 0% for the wider region.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£314/sq ft) was about 48.3%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 73 m² it sits well below the postcode median (145 m² across 12 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ally. Most recent transfer: April 2021 at £246,500. Across the public record there are 5 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
Bicester House has changed hands more often than typical for the area.
